Output 3dd948d1882c714eff684817e8edcd8c2db007b4beb2fe146bc2a5a48695955f:0

value
3509590
script pubkey
OP_0 OP_PUSHBYTES_20 ab3628d2974706ee5fdd262b26ad3f24d8aebe44
address
bc1q4vmz355hgurwuh7ayc4jdtflynv2a0jytaaelf
transaction
3dd948d1882c714eff684817e8edcd8c2db007b4beb2fe146bc2a5a48695955f
confirmations
166366
spent
true